Lots of private overall health coverage designs in Colorado will before long be required to include “gender affirming treatment” for transgender people below a landmark acceptance granted by the Biden administration.
For the 1st time, programs obtained on the state’s individual and compact team marketplaces — meaning companies with a lot less than 100 workers — will be essential to address transition-linked treatment. The improve would get result on Jan. 1, 2023.
According to condition figures, the compact team and personal overall health insurance plan marketplaces protect about 20 percent of Coloradans.
The treatments will consist of hormone therapy, genital reconstruction, confront tightening, facial bone transforming and other services.
Biden administration officers mentioned the hope is Colorado can deliver a product for other states to be certain entry to potentially lifesaving treatment.

The administration earlier this yr mentioned it would reverse Trump-era limitations on overall health treatment protections towards discrimination centered on gender identity and sexual orientation.
CMS in a assertion explained it recognizes that expanded, gender-affirming coverage “vastly enhances well being care outcomes for the LGBTQ+ local community, cuts down large premiums of depression, stress, and suicide makes an attempt as nicely as decreases substance use, improves HIV treatment adherence, and cuts down fees of dangerous self-recommended hormone use.”
The variations to the coverage rules would incorporate expanded protection for transition products and services to ObamaCare’s “important rewards” all designs ought to assure to their shoppers.
Though ObamaCare defines the broad types of crucial well being rewards, states have the flexibility to create wellbeing options that element the distinct expert services included dependent on a normal employer program.

In accordance to Polis, all insurance policy corporations in the state will have to cover some kind of gender-affirming care. Having said that, protection varies by insurance plan firm, is not often extensive and could contain express exclusions for sure providers, even if a health and fitness care supplier decides a provider to be medically important.
In other states, primarily those people operate by Republican governors, entry to gender-affirming care is exceptionally minimal.
The previous administration’s HHS kept protections versus discrimination based on race, color, countrywide origin, intercourse, age or disability. But officials narrowed the definition of sex to only mean “biological intercourse,” precisely chopping out transgender people.
